#d51123 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#d51123 is composed of 83.5% red, 6.7% green and 13.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 92% magenta, 83.6% yellow and 16.5% black. It has a hue angle of 354.5 degrees, a saturation of 85.2% and a lightness of 45.1%. #d51123 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ff2246 with #ab0000. Closest websafe color is: #cc0033.

Shades and Tints of #d51123

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0d0102 is the darkest color, while #fffafa is the lightest one.

Tones of #d51123

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#747272 is the less saturated color, while #de081c is the most saturated one.
